Learn about CVE-2023-49554, a Use After Free vulnerability in YASM 1.3.0.86.g9def that allows remote attackers to cause denial of service. Explore impact, technical details, and mitigation strategies.
A detailed analysis of the Use After Free vulnerability in YASM 1.3.0.86.g9def and its impacts, technical details, and mitigation strategies.
Understanding CVE-2023-49554
This section delves into the specifics of the CVE-2023-49554 vulnerability affecting YASM 1.3.0.86.g9def.
What is CVE-2023-49554?
CVE-2023-49554 is a Use After Free vulnerability in YASM 1.3.0.86.g9def that allows a remote attacker to cause a denial of service through a specific component.
The Impact of CVE-2023-49554
The vulnerability could be exploited by a remote attacker, leading to a denial of service, impacting the availability of the affected system.
Technical Details of CVE-2023-49554
This section outlines the technical aspects and implications of the CVE-2023-49554 vulnerability.
Vulnerability Description
The Use After Free vulnerability arises in the do_directive function within the modules/preprocs/nasm/nasm-pp.c component of YASM 1.3.0.86.g9def.
Affected Systems and Versions
The vulnerability impacts YASM version 1.3.0.86.g9def.
Exploitation Mechanism
A remote attacker can exploit this vulnerability to trigger a denial of service attack by manipulating the do_directive function.
Mitigation and Prevention
In this section, we explore the steps to mitigate and prevent the exploitation of CVE-2023-49554.
Immediate Steps to Take
It is recommended to apply security patches provided by the vendor to address the vulnerability promptly.
Long-Term Security Practices
To enhance security posture, organizations should implement secure coding practices and conduct regular security assessments.
Patching and Updates
Regularly updating software components like YASM to the latest versions can help in eliminating vulnerabilities and enhancing system security.